The CCE Dining Experience

Members of Conference Centres of Excellence strive for the highest possible standards of food preparation, using the best of locally sourced ingredients where possible.

Dining with Conference Centres of ExcellenceHealthy options are a feature of all meals and most diets can be catered for with notice in advance. Overall are aim is to provide supportive catering arrangements that meet the
needs of conference delegates attending our venues for a variety of purposes, but in general breakfast and lunch dining options tend to be less formal than dinner, which suits most of our customers.

Event organisers should always discuss catering arrangements with our venues if they would like to do something a bit different, such as a barbecue or picnic as are members are happy to be flexible and endeavour to make your event a success.
